export type DocumentInitParameters = {
    /**
     * - The URL of the PDF.
     */
    url?: string | URL | undefined;
    /**
     * -
     * Binary PDF data.
     * Use TypedArrays (Uint8Array) to improve the memory usage. If PDF data is
     * BASE64-encoded, use `atob()` to convert it to a binary string first.
     *
     * NOTE: If TypedArrays are used they will generally be transferred to the
     * worker-thread. This will help reduce main-thread memory usage, however
     * it will take ownership of the TypedArrays.
     */
    data?: string | number[] | ArrayBuffer | TypedArray | undefined;
    /**
     * - Basic authentication headers.
     */
    httpHeaders?: Object | undefined;
    /**
     * - Indicates whether or not
     * cross-site Access-Control requests should be made using credentials such
     * as cookies or authorization headers. The default is `false`.
     */
    withCredentials?: boolean | undefined;
    /**
     * - For decrypting password-protected PDFs.
     */
    password?: string | undefined;
    /**
     * - The PDF file length. It's used for progress
     * reports and range requests operations.
     */
    length?: number | undefined;
    /**
     * - Allows for using a custom range
     * transport implementation.
     */
    range?: PDFDataRangeTransport | undefined;
    /**
     * - Specify maximum number of bytes fetched
     * per range request. The default value is 65536 (= 2^16).
     */
    rangeChunkSize?: number | undefined;
    /**
     * - The worker that will be used for loading and
     * parsing the PDF data.
     */
    worker?: PDFWorker | undefined;
    /**
     * - Controls the logging level; the constants
     * from {@link VerbosityLevel} should be used.
     */
    verbosity?: number | undefined;
    /**
     * - The base URL of the document, used when
     * attempting to recover valid absolute URLs for annotations, and outline
     * items, that (incorrectly) only specify relative URLs.
     */
    docBaseUrl?: string | undefined;
    /**
     * - The URL where the predefined Adobe CMaps are
     * located. Include the trailing slash.
     */
    cMapUrl?: string | undefined;
    /**
     * - Specifies if the Adobe CMaps are binary
     * packed or not. The default value is `true`.
     */
    cMapPacked?: boolean | undefined;
    /**
     * - The factory that will be used when
     * reading built-in CMap files.
     * The default value is {DOMCMapReaderFactory}.
     */
    CMapReaderFactory?: Object | undefined;
    /**
     * - The URL where the predefined ICC profiles are
     * located. Include the trailing slash.
     */
    iccUrl?: string | undefined;
    /**
     * - When `true`, fonts that aren't
     * embedded in the PDF document will fallback to a system font.
     * The default value is `true` in web environments and `false` in Node.js;
     * unless `disableFontFace === true` in which case this defaults to `false`
     * regardless of the environment (to prevent completely broken fonts).
     */
    useSystemFonts?: boolean | undefined;
    /**
     * - The URL where the standard font
     * files are located. Include the trailing slash.
     */
    standardFontDataUrl?: string | undefined;
    /**
     * - The factory that will be used
     * when reading the standard font files.
     * The default value is {DOMStandardFontDataFactory}.
     */
    StandardFontDataFactory?: Object | undefined;
    /**
     * - The URL where the wasm files are located.
     * Include the trailing slash.
     */
    wasmUrl?: string | undefined;
    /**
     * - The factory that will be used
     * when reading the wasm files.
     * The default value is {DOMWasmFactory}.
     */
    WasmFactory?: Object | undefined;
    /**
     * - Enable using the Fetch API in the
     * worker-thread when reading CMap and standard font files. When `true`,
     * the `CMapReaderFactory`, `StandardFontDataFactory`, and `WasmFactory`
     * options are ignored.
     * The default value is `true` in web environments and `false` in Node.js.
     */
    useWorkerFetch?: boolean | undefined;
    /**
     * - Attempt to use WebAssembly in order to
     * improve e.g. image decoding performance.
     * The default value is `true`.
     */
    useWasm?: boolean | undefined;
    /**
     * - Reject certain promises, e.g.
     * `getOperatorList`, `getTextContent`, and `RenderTask`, when the associated
     * PDF data cannot be successfully parsed, instead of attempting to recover
     * whatever possible of the data. The default value is `false`.
     */
    stopAtErrors?: boolean | undefined;
    /**
     * - The maximum allowed image size in total
     * pixels, i.e. width * height. Images above this value will not be rendered.
     * Use -1 for no limit, which is also the default value.
     */
    maxImageSize?: number | undefined;
    /**
     * - Determines if we can evaluate strings
     * as JavaScript. Primarily used to improve performance of PDF functions.
     * The default value is `true`.
     */
    isEvalSupported?: boolean | undefined;
    /**
     * - Determines if we can use
     * `OffscreenCanvas` in the worker. Primarily used to improve performance of
     * image conversion/rendering.
     * The default value is `true` in web environments and `false` in Node.js.
     */
    isOffscreenCanvasSupported?: boolean | undefined;
    /**
     * - Determines if we can use
     * `ImageDecoder` in the worker. Primarily used to improve performance of
     * image conversion/rendering.
     * The default value is `true` in web environments and `false` in Node.js.
     *
     * NOTE: Also temporarily disabled in Chromium browsers, until we no longer
     * support the affected browser versions, because of various bugs:
     *
     * - Crashes when using the BMP decoder with huge images, e.g. issue6741.pdf;
     * see https://issues.chromium.org/issues/374807001
     *
     * - Broken images when using the JPEG decoder with images that have custom
     * colour profiles, e.g. GitHub discussion 19030;
     * see https://issues.chromium.org/issues/378869810
     */
    isImageDecoderSupported?: boolean | undefined;
    /**
     * - The integer value is used to
     * know when an image must be resized (uses `OffscreenCanvas` in the worker).
     * If it's -1 then a possibly slow algorithm is used to guess the max value.
     */
    canvasMaxAreaInBytes?: number | undefined;
    /**
     * - By default fonts are converted to
     * OpenType fonts and loaded via the Font Loading API or `@font-face` rules.
     * If disabled, fonts will be rendered using a built-in font renderer that
     * constructs the glyphs with primitive path commands.
     * The default value is `false` in web environments and `true` in Node.js.
     */
    disableFontFace?: boolean | undefined;
    /**
     * - Include additional properties,
     * which are unused during rendering of PDF documents, when exporting the
     * parsed font data from the worker-thread. This may be useful for debugging
     * purposes (and backwards compatibility), but note that it will lead to
     * increased memory usage. The default value is `false`.
     */
    fontExtraProperties?: boolean | undefined;
    /**
     * - Render Xfa forms if any.
     * The default value is `false`.
     */
    enableXfa?: boolean | undefined;
    /**
     * - Specify an explicit document
     * context to create elements with and to load resources, such as fonts,
     * into. Defaults to the current document.
     */
    ownerDocument?: HTMLDocument | undefined;
    /**
     * - Disable range request loading of PDF
     * files. When enabled, and if the server supports partial content requests,
     * then the PDF will be fetched in chunks. The default value is `false`.
     */
    disableRange?: boolean | undefined;
    /**
     * - Disable streaming of PDF file data.
     * By default PDF.js attempts to load PDF files in chunks. The default value
     * is `false`.
     */
    disableStream?: boolean | undefined;
    /**
     * - Disable pre-fetching of PDF file
     * data. When range requests are enabled PDF.js will automatically keep
     * fetching more data even if it isn't needed to display the current page.
     * The default value is `false`.
     *
     * NOTE: It is also necessary to disable streaming, see above, in order for
     * disabling of pre-fetching to work correctly.
     */
    disableAutoFetch?: boolean | undefined;
    /**
     * - Enables special hooks for debugging PDF.js
     * (see `web/debugger.js`). The default value is `false`.
     */
    pdfBug?: boolean | undefined;
    /**
     * - The factory that will be used when
     * creating canvases. The default value is {DOMCanvasFactory}.
     */
    CanvasFactory?: Object | undefined;
    /**
     * - The factory that will be used to
     * create SVG filters when rendering some images on the main canvas.
     * The default value is {DOMFilterFactory}.
     */
    FilterFactory?: Object | undefined;
    /**
     * - Enables hardware acceleration for
     * rendering. The default value is `false`.
     */
    enableHWA?: boolean | undefined;
};

/**
 * Page render parameters.
 */
export type RenderParameters = {
    /**
     * - A DOM Canvas object. The default
     * value is the canvas associated with the `canvasContext` parameter if no
     * value is provided explicitly.
     */
    canvas: HTMLCanvasElement | null;
    /**
     * - Rendering viewport obtained by calling
     * the `PDFPageProxy.getViewport` method.
     */
    viewport: PageViewport;
    /**
     * - 2D context of a DOM
     * Canvas object for backwards compatibility; it is recommended to use the
     * `canvas` parameter instead.
     * If the context must absolutely be used to render the page, the canvas must
     * be null.
     */
    canvasContext?: CanvasRenderingContext2D | undefined;
    /**
     * - Rendering intent, can be 'display', 'print',
     * or 'any'. The default value is 'display'.
     */
    intent?: string | undefined;
    /**
     * Controls which annotations are rendered
     * onto the canvas, for annotations with appearance-data; the values from
     * {@link AnnotationMode} should be used. The following values are supported:
     * - `AnnotationMode.DISABLE`, which disables all annotations.
     * - `AnnotationMode.ENABLE`, which includes all possible annotations (thus
     * it also depends on the `intent`-option, see above).
     * - `AnnotationMode.ENABLE_FORMS`, which excludes annotations that contain
     * interactive form elements (those will be rendered in the display layer).
     * - `AnnotationMode.ENABLE_STORAGE`, which includes all possible annotations
     * (as above) but where interactive form elements are updated with data
     * from the {@link AnnotationStorage}-instance; useful e.g. for printing.
     * The default value is `AnnotationMode.ENABLE`.
     */
    annotationMode?: number | undefined;
    /**
     * - Additional transform, applied just
     * before viewport transform.
     */
    transform?: any[] | undefined;
    /**
     * - Background
     * to use for the canvas.
     * Any valid `canvas.fillStyle` can be used: a `DOMString` parsed as CSS
     * <color> value, a `CanvasGradient` object (a linear or radial gradient) or
     * a `CanvasPattern` object (a repetitive image). The default value is
     * 'rgb(255,255,255)'.
     *
     * NOTE: This option may be partially, or completely, ignored when the
     * `pageColors`-option is used.
     */
    background?: string | CanvasGradient | CanvasPattern | undefined;
    /**
     * - Overwrites background and foreground colors
     * with user defined ones in order to improve readability in high contrast
     * mode.
     */
    pageColors?: Object | undefined;
    /**
     * -
     * A promise that should resolve with an {@link OptionalContentConfig}created from `PDFDocumentProxy.getOptionalContentConfig`. If `null`,
     * the configuration will be fetched automatically with the default visibility
     * states set.
     */
    optionalContentConfigPromise?: Promise<OptionalContentConfig> | undefined;
    /**
     * - Map some
     * annotation ids with canvases used to render them.
     */
    annotationCanvasMap?: Map<string, HTMLCanvasElement> | undefined;
    printAnnotationStorage?: PrintAnnotationStorage | undefined;
    /**
     * - Render the page in editing mode.
     */
    isEditing?: boolean | undefined;
    /**
     * - Record the dependencies and bounding
     * boxes of all PDF operations that render onto the canvas.
     */
    recordOperations?: boolean | undefined;
    /**
     * - If provided, only
     * run for which this function returns `true`.
     */
    operationsFilter?: OperationsFilter | undefined;
};

/**
 * This is the main entry point for loading a PDF and interacting with it.
 *
 * NOTE: If a URL is used to fetch the PDF data a standard Fetch API call (or
 * XHR as fallback) is used, which means it must follow same origin rules,
 * e.g. no cross-domain requests without CORS.
 *
 * @param {string | URL | TypedArray | ArrayBuffer | DocumentInitParameters}
 *   src - Can be a URL where a PDF file is located, a typed array (Uint8Array)
 *         already populated with data, or a parameter object.
 * @returns {PDFDocumentLoadingTask}
 */
export function getDocument(src?: string | URL | TypedArray | ArrayBuffer | DocumentInitParameters): PDFDocumentLoadingTask;

/**
 * Proxy to a `PDFDocument` in the worker thread.
 */
export class PDFDocumentProxy {
    constructor(pdfInfo: any, transport: any);
    _pdfInfo: any;
    _transport: any;
    /**
     * @type {AnnotationStorage} Storage for annotation data in forms.
     */
    get annotationStorage(): AnnotationStorage;
    /**
     * @type {Object} The canvas factory instance.
     */
    get canvasFactory(): Object;
    /**
     * @type {Object} The filter factory instance.
     */
    get filterFactory(): Object;
    /**
     * @type {number} Total number of pages in the PDF file.
     */
    get numPages(): number;
    /**
     * @type {Array<string | null>} A (not guaranteed to be) unique ID to identify
     *   the PDF document.
     *   NOTE: The first element will always be defined for all PDF documents,
     *   whereas the second element is only defined for *modified* PDF documents.
     */
    get fingerprints(): Array<string | null>;
    /**
     * @type {boolean} True if only XFA form.
     */
    get isPureXfa(): boolean;
    /**
     * NOTE: This is (mostly) intended to support printing of XFA forms.
     *
     * @type {Object | null} An object representing a HTML tree structure
     *   to render the XFA, or `null` when no XFA form exists.
     */
    get allXfaHtml(): Object | null;
    /**
     * @param {number} pageNumber - The page number to get. The first page is 1.
     * @returns {Promise<PDFPageProxy>} A promise that is resolved with
     *   a {@link PDFPageProxy} object.
     */
    getPage(pageNumber: number): Promise<PDFPageProxy>;
    /**
     * @param {RefProxy} ref - The page reference.
     * @returns {Promise<number>} A promise that is resolved with the page index,
     *   starting from zero, that is associated with the reference.
     */
    getPageIndex(ref: RefProxy): Promise<number>;
    /**
     * @returns {Promise<Object<string, Array<any>>>} A promise that is resolved
     *   with a mapping from named destinations to references.
     *
     * This can be slow for large documents. Use `getDestination` instead.
     */
    getDestinations(): Promise<{
        [x: string]: Array<any>;
    }>;
    /**
     * @param {string} id - The named destination to get.
     * @returns {Promise<Array<any> | null>} A promise that is resolved with all
     *   information of the given named destination, or `null` when the named
     *   destination is not present in the PDF file.
     */
    getDestination(id: string): Promise<Array<any> | null>;
    /**
     * @returns {Promise<Array<string> | null>} A promise that is resolved with
     *   an {Array} containing the page labels that correspond to the page
     *   indexes, or `null` when no page labels are present in the PDF file.
     */
    getPageLabels(): Promise<Array<string> | null>;
    /**
     * @returns {Promise<string>} A promise that is resolved with a {string}
     *   containing the page layout name.
     */
    getPageLayout(): Promise<string>;
    /**
     * @returns {Promise<string>} A promise that is resolved with a {string}
     *   containing the page mode name.
     */
    getPageMode(): Promise<string>;
    /**
     * @returns {Promise<Object | null>} A promise that is resolved with an
     *   {Object} containing the viewer preferences, or `null` when no viewer
     *   preferences are present in the PDF file.
     */
    getViewerPreferences(): Promise<Object | null>;
    /**
     * @returns {Promise<any | null>} A promise that is resolved with an {Array}
     *   containing the destination, or `null` when no open action is present
     *   in the PDF.
     */
    getOpenAction(): Promise<any | null>;
    /**
     * @returns {Promise<any>} A promise that is resolved with a lookup table
     *   for mapping named attachments to their content.
     */
    getAttachments(): Promise<any>;
    /**
     * @param {Set<number>} types - The annotation types to retrieve.
     * @param {Set<number>} pageIndexesToSkip
     * @returns {Promise<Array<Object>>} A promise that is resolved with a list of
     *   annotations data.
     */
    getAnnotationsByType(types: Set<number>, pageIndexesToSkip: Set<number>): Promise<Array<Object>>;
    /**
     * @returns {Promise<Object | null>} A promise that is resolved with
     *   an {Object} with the JavaScript actions:
     *     - from the name tree.
     *     - from A or AA entries in the catalog dictionary.
     *   , or `null` if no JavaScript exists.
     */
    getJSActions(): Promise<Object | null>;
    /**
     * @typedef {Object} OutlineNode
     * @property {string} title
     * @property {boolean} bold
     * @property {boolean} italic
     * @property {Uint8ClampedArray} color - The color in RGB format to use for
     *   display purposes.
     * @property {string | Array<any> | null} dest
     * @property {string | null} url
     * @property {string | undefined} unsafeUrl
     * @property {boolean | undefined} newWindow
     * @property {number | undefined} count
     * @property {Array<OutlineNode>} items
     */
    /**
     * @returns {Promise<Array<OutlineNode>>} A promise that is resolved with an
     *   {Array} that is a tree outline (if it has one) of the PDF file.
     */
    getOutline(): Promise<Array<{
        title: string;
        bold: boolean;
        italic: boolean;
        /**
         * - The color in RGB format to use for
         * display purposes.
         */
        color: Uint8ClampedArray;
        dest: string | Array<any> | null;
        url: string | null;
        unsafeUrl: string | undefined;
        newWindow: boolean | undefined;
        count: number | undefined;
        items: Array</*elided*/ any>;
    }>>;
    /**
     * @typedef {Object} GetOptionalContentConfigParameters
     * @property {string} [intent] - Determines the optional content groups that
     *   are visible by default; valid values are:
     *    - 'display' (viewable groups).
     *    - 'print' (printable groups).
     *    - 'any' (all groups).
     *   The default value is 'display'.
     */
    /**
     * @param {GetOptionalContentConfigParameters} [params] - Optional content
     *   config parameters.
     * @returns {Promise<OptionalContentConfig>} A promise that is resolved with
     *   an {@link OptionalContentConfig} that contains all the optional content
     *   groups (assuming that the document has any).
     */
    getOptionalContentConfig({ intent }?: {
        /**
         * - Determines the optional content groups that
         * are visible by default; valid values are:
         * - 'display' (viewable groups).
         * - 'print' (printable groups).
         * - 'any' (all groups).
         * The default value is 'display'.
         */
        intent?: string | undefined;
    }): Promise<OptionalContentConfig>;
    /**
     * @returns {Promise<Array<number> | null>} A promise that is resolved with
     *   an {Array} that contains the permission flags for the PDF document, or
     *   `null` when no permissions are present in the PDF file.
     */
    getPermissions(): Promise<Array<number> | null>;
    /**
     * @returns {Promise<{ info: Object, metadata: Metadata }>} A promise that is
     *   resolved with an {Object} that has `info` and `metadata` properties.
     *   `info` is an {Object} filled with anything available in the information
     *   dictionary and similarly `metadata` is a {Metadata} object with
     *   information from the metadata section of the PDF.
     */
    getMetadata(): Promise<{
        info: Object;
        metadata: Metadata;
    }>;
    /**
     * @typedef {Object} MarkInfo
     * Properties correspond to Table 321 of the PDF 32000-1:2008 spec.
     * @property {boolean} Marked
     * @property {boolean} UserProperties
     * @property {boolean} Suspects
     */
    /**
     * @returns {Promise<MarkInfo | null>} A promise that is resolved with
     *   a {MarkInfo} object that contains the MarkInfo flags for the PDF
     *   document, or `null` when no MarkInfo values are present in the PDF file.
     */
    getMarkInfo(): Promise<{
        Marked: boolean;
        UserProperties: boolean;
        Suspects: boolean;
    } | null>;
    /**
     * @returns {Promise<Uint8Array>} A promise that is resolved with a
     *   {Uint8Array} containing the raw data of the PDF document.
     */
    getData(): Promise<Uint8Array>;
    /**
     * @returns {Promise<Uint8Array>} A promise that is resolved with a
     *   {Uint8Array} containing the full data of the saved document.
     */
    saveDocument(): Promise<Uint8Array>;
    /**
     * @returns {Promise<{ length: number }>} A promise that is resolved when the
     *   document's data is loaded. It is resolved with an {Object} that contains
     *   the `length` property that indicates size of the PDF data in bytes.
     */
    getDownloadInfo(): Promise<{
        length: number;
    }>;
    /**
     * Cleans up resources allocated by the document on both the main and worker
     * threads.
     *
     * NOTE: Do not, under any circumstances, call this method when rendering is
     * currently ongoing since that may lead to rendering errors.
     *
     * @param {boolean} [keepLoadedFonts] - Let fonts remain attached to the DOM.
     *   NOTE: This will increase persistent memory usage, hence don't use this
     *   option unless absolutely necessary. The default value is `false`.
     * @returns {Promise} A promise that is resolved when clean-up has finished.
     */
    cleanup(keepLoadedFonts?: boolean): Promise<any>;
    /**
     * Destroys the current document instance and terminates the worker.
     */
    destroy(): Promise<void>;
    /**
     * @param {RefProxy} ref - The page reference.
     * @returns {number | null} The page number, if it's cached.
     */
    cachedPageNumber(ref: RefProxy): number | null;
    /**
     * @type {DocumentInitParameters} A subset of the current
     *   {DocumentInitParameters}, which are needed in the viewer.
     */
    get loadingParams(): DocumentInitParameters;
    /**
     * @type {PDFDocumentLoadingTask} The loadingTask for the current document.
     */
    get loadingTask(): PDFDocumentLoadingTask;
    /**
     * @returns {Promise<Object<string, Array<Object>> | null>} A promise that is
     *   resolved with an {Object} containing /AcroForm field data for the JS
     *   sandbox, or `null` when no field data is present in the PDF file.
     */
    getFieldObjects(): Promise<{
        [x: string]: Array<Object>;
    } | null>;
    /**
     * @returns {Promise<boolean>} A promise that is resolved with `true`
     *   if some /AcroForm fields have JavaScript actions.
     */
    hasJSActions(): Promise<boolean>;
    /**
     * @returns {Promise<Array<string> | null>} A promise that is resolved with an
     *   {Array<string>} containing IDs of annotations that have a calculation
     *   action, or `null` when no such annotations are present in the PDF file.
     */
    getCalculationOrderIds(): Promise<Array<string> | null>;
}
